Abstract

PT Gajah Tunggal Tbk Plant D Radial do green tire production scheduling use conventional, There are frequent delays in fulfillment due date target on completion of curing production. Based on these problems the company wants significant changes, especially on the production scheduling in order to meet the target delay maturity that often occurs can be minimized. Prior to the program created, an algorithm of green tire production scheduling system will be designed using the earliest due date method. Method of Earliest Due Date (EDD) is a method of production scheduling that generates the maximum tardiness as minimum. This method sort tasks by due date are nearby. To find out how far the influence of using earliest due date for production scheduling , there are calculation of average tardiness time, performed by calculating the tardiness between the existing scheduling and the proposed scheduling which using the earliest due date. The calculation is on a single line of building machine (6 building machine). There was a decrease in average tardiness 25 percent between existing scheduling with proposed scheduling. So the production scheduling information system with EDD method can minimize the maximum delay and better than the way conventional Keywords: scheduling, conventional, earliest due date, maximum tardiness. PT Gajah Tunggal Tbk Plant D Radial selama ini melakukan penjadwalan produksi green tire secara konvensional, sehingga sering terjadi keterlambatan dalam memenuhi target jatuh tempo penyelesaian produksi curing. Berdasarkan permasalahan tersebut perusahaan menginginkan perubahan yang signifikan terutama pada penjadwalan produksi agar keterlambatan dalam memenuhi target jatuh tempo yang sering terjadi dapat diminimalkan. Sebelum dibuatkan program maka dirancang algoritma system penjadwalan produksi green tire dengan menggunakan metode earliest due date. Metode earliest due date (edd) merupakan metode penjadwalan produksi yang menghasilkan maximum tardiness yang paling minimum. Metode ini mengurutkan pekerjaan-pekerjaan berdasarkan tanggal jatuh tempo (due date) yang terdekat. Untuk mengetahui seberapa jauh pengaruh penggunaan metode earliest due date terhadap penjadwalan produksi maka dilakukan penghitungan waktu rata-rata tardiness terhadap penjadwalan yang dilakukan saat ini dan dibandingkan dengan waktu rata-rata tardiness untuk usulan penjadwalan yang menggunakan earliest due date. Perhitungan waktu rata- rata tardiness ini dilakukan pada satu line mesin building (6 mesin building). Dari perhitungan waktu rata-rata tardiness pada penjadwalan saat ini dengan usulan rancangan, didapatkan hasil penurunan waktu rata-rata tardiness sebesar 25 persen. Jadi sistem informasi penjadwalan produksi dengan metode EDD dapat meminimalkan keterlambatan maksimum dan lebih baik dibandingkan dengan cara konvensional.
